Koaru wrote: |
Aren't awe-inspiring hits supposed to kill the creature automatically? |
Awe-inspiring hits aren't a guaranteed kill - I think it really depends on the creature your character is fighting, the weapon being used, and your character's Perception (see News 16) or Strength (depending on what type of weapon).
For instance (and both of these creatures are way beneath my character Dzynna), she can one-hit kill a vacori but it takes multiple shots to take down a getok hound. Both are level 70, and I'm referring to continuous awe-inspiring hits to the head. Modan Kucho (level 75) it usually takes her two hits.
She uses a max-quality enhanced heavy crossbow from King's Ransom, and this is with 125 Perception (plus she is Darju so night/day doesn't affect her). _________________
